Reality Show Gets the Big Advertising Buck

The success of ‘American Idol’ has put Fox in a comfortable ratings positions and is allowing it to charge $950,000 for a :30 in the season finale. And media buyers are willingly paying that price as well as $550,000 for the finale of ‘Joe Millionaire’.

I say pay it while the audience is there. I also say the audience will be there about as long as the ‘Who Wants to be a Millionaire’ audience was.
